1. 什么是区块链电子钱包
区块链电子钱包是一种数字化的钱包,使用区块链技术来存储和管理各种加密资产,包括比特币、以太坊等加密货币。它提供了一个安全、便捷的方式,让用户轻松地发送、接收和管理加密资产。
2. 区块链电子钱包的设计原理
区块链电子钱包的设计原理主要包括公私钥对、数字签名和区块链网络通信。
首先,每个用户在创建钱包时会生成一对公私钥。公钥用于接收加密资产,而私钥则用于对交易进行数字签名。
其次,数字签名是保证交易安全和身份验证的重要机制。通过使用私钥对交易进行数字签名,可以验证该交易确实是由该钱包的所有者发起的。
最后,区块链电子钱包需要与区块链网络进行通信,以查询余额、发送和接收交易等操作。它通过连接到区块链节点,与网络进行交互,将交易广播到整个网络中,以便其他节点进行验证和确认。
3. 区块链电子钱包的安全性
区块链电子钱包的安全性是设计原理的核心考虑因素之一。以下是几种常见的安全保护措施:
- 强大的加密算法:钱包的私钥和交易信息都会进行加密,确保只有拥有私钥的用户才能访问和操作。
- 多重身份验证:钱包可以设置多重身份验证机制,例如密码、指纹、面部识别等,以增强用户账户的安全性。
- 安全存储:私钥需要妥善保存,可以选择离线存储或硬件钱包等方式,防止私钥被黑客或恶意软件攻击。
- 审计和监管:一些电子钱包提供审计和监管功能,用户可以追踪和监控钱包交易记录,发现异常行为并及时采取措施。
4. 区块链电子钱包的优势和未来发展
区块链电子钱包相比传统的银行系统和第三方支付方式具有以下优势:
- 去中心化:区块链电子钱包直接由用户控制,无需信任中心化的银行或支付机构。
- 透明性:区块链上的所有交易信息都是公开可查的,用户可以自由查阅和验证。
- 低手续费:区块链电子钱包的交易手续费相对较低,降低用户的交易成本。
- 全球化:区块链电子钱包可以实现全球范围内的即时支付和转账,无受限地域或跨境限制。
未来发展方向包括更高级别的安全技术、更智能的用户界面和更多加密资产的支持,以满足用户对安全性和便捷性的不断需求。